You can delete lots permanently from inside the bin. When you select the lot in the bin you no longer wish to keep, you can click on the little trash can in the lower right hand corner (right under the scroll arrow) and it will be removed.


And that should work just fine. I've done it repeatedly and the lots I deleted in this manner are gone.

Thanks for all the replies.  I believe the bulldozing action just removes the house from the lot but the house reappears in the bin.  Deleting from the bin should get rid of the house completely.

Actually you can take any pre-made Maxis house that are in a neighborhood, place it in the bin and then place it back where it was and it will automaticaly have done a copy of that house in the "housebin". It will be there forever unless you manually delete it from the "housebin".  So before you place a house in the "housebin" if you want to use it a few times modify it before you place it in the bin otherwise you will end-up with 2 or 3 different version of the same house (if you move each version in the housebin) which can take a lot of place if you happen to have a lot of custom stuff in each house.

I find this feature very interesting since some of the pre-made Maxis house are well done and it is a time saving when we create new neighborhoods.  Also very useful for community lots that we don't have to do over and over again.
